NWJHL welcoming back Beaverlodge Blades, introducing La Crete Lumber Barons

The Beaverlodge Blades are again returning to the North West Junior Hockey League. They are one of two teams the league is welcoming this year, along with the La Crete Lumber Barons, a brand new team.

The Blades last played in the 2017-2018 season after pulling out of the 2016-2017 season mid-season due to financial problems. The team again went on leave in the 2018-2019 season.

A camp is scheduled for September 2nd to 4th at the Crosslink County Sportsplex. Their return was also celebrated with a dinner and dance fundraiser at the Beaverlodge Arena Saturday.

Leading the squad this season will be GM/Head Coach Ed Widdifield, a longtime area resident with an extensive coaching history. He’s joined by Assistant Coach Colin Lefley, well known for his time with the Spirit River Rangers of the North Peace Hockey League.

This season for the NWJHL will consist of eight teams each playing 42 regular season games, starting September 22nd. Also in the league are the County of Grande Prairie Wheat Kings, Dawson Creek Kodiaks, Fairview Flyers, Fort St. John Huskies, North Peace Navigators, and Sundown Oilfield Sexsmith Vipers.
